Image Over Frame Library

The Image Over Frame Library is a JavaScript library that allows you to overlay one image on top of another with ease. It uses the Jimp library for image manipulation, and it's suitable for adding watermarks, logos, or any other images to an existing image.

Installation

You can install the image-over-frame library via npm:

npm install image-over-frame

Usage

Here's how you can use the image-over-frame library in your Node.js project:

const imageOverlay = require('image-over-frame');

// Define the paths to your frame image and second image
const frameImagePath = 'path/to/frame.png';
const secondImagePath = 'path/to/second_image.png';
const outputImagePath = 'output_image.png';

// Overlay the second image on the frame image
imageOverlay.overlayImages(frameImagePath, secondImagePath, outputImagePath, (err) => {
  if (err) {
    console.error('Error:', err);
  } else {
    console.log('Overlay complete. Result saved to', outputImagePath);
  }
});

API

overlayImages(framePath, secondImagePath, outputPath, callback)

  • framePath (string): The path to the frame image.
  • secondImagePath (string): The path to the second image.
  • outputPath (string): The path where the resulting image will be saved.
  • callback (function): A callback function that will be called after the overlay operation is complete. It will receive an error object as its first argument (or null if successful).
